What is Youth Programs International?

Youth Programs International involves youth around the world in Habitat for Humanity’s global mission. In doing so, it brings new energy and leadership to the organization.

Where does Youth Programs International work?

Youth Programs International works wherever Habitat is present around the world! Youth Programs coordinators work in Habitat for Humanity International offices in Africa and the Middle East, Asia and the Pacific, Europe and Central Asia, and Latin America and the Caribbean. How can I get involved?

There are many ways youth around the world can get involved with Habitat for Humanity:

  • Join or start a Habitat for Humanity youth organization in your community.
    Community youth groups are youth-run organizations led by youth from local schools, churches, businesses, homeowner youth and other service organizations. They work in partnership with local Habitat affiliates in construction, education and fund-raising.
  • Campus chapters, often called student groups or clubs, are student-run organizations on a university or high school campus. Campus chapters perform four main functions: building, fund raising, advocating and educating. Visit the Campus Chapters page for more information on the Campus Chapters program.
